Market Overview

Home Prices in Texarkana, TX

The median home value in Texarkana, TX is $203,306 as of mid-2026, according to Zillow's Home Value Index (ZHVI).That's up 2.8% compared to a year ago and down 3% from two years prior.

Compared to the U.S. national median of $410,000, homes in Texarkana are priced50% below average. Texarkana is part of the Texarkana, TX-AR metro area.

Over the past five years, Texarkana home values have risen by approximately13.9%, reflecting steady appreciation in this market.

Affordability

What Does It Cost to Buy in Texarkana?

20% Down Payment
$40,661
on $203,306
Monthly P&I
$1,060/mo
30-yr @ 6.8%
Total Monthly Est.
~$1,346/mo
incl. taxes & insurance
Income Needed
$53,840
gross annual (30% rule)
10% Down Option
$20,331
+ PMI applies
Loan Amount (20% dn)
$162,645
at current rates

Estimates assume a 30-year fixed mortgage at 6.8%. Monthly total includes estimated property taxes and homeowner's insurance. Actual costs vary.
